The Core Technological Logic Behind The Miniaturization Of Heavy-duty Connectors

Space optimization dictates contemporary industrial design. As equipment shrinks, heavy-duty connectors must deliver identical power ratings within reduced footprints. Miniaturization relies on advanced material science and high-density contact layouts to maintain reliable electrical paths under severe mechanical stress.

Driving factors for the reduction in size of heavy-duty connectors

Achieving compact profiles involves specific design strategies that prevent electrical failure while maximizing space utility.

Insulation and Housing Materials

Miniaturized heavy duty wire connectors utilize high-grade engineering plastics with superior dielectric strength. These materials allow thinner walls between contact pins without risking electrical arcing. Consequently, a wire connector heavy duty variant achieves up to a 40% reduction in housing volume while sustaining traditional voltage thresholds.

High-Density Contact Architecture

Modern manufacturing utilizes specialized copper alloys that possess high conductivity and relaxation resistance. This allows closer pin spacing in heavy duty electric cable connectors.

Feature Standard Design Miniaturized Design
Pitch Distance 5.0 mm 3.5 mm
Current Density 10 A/mm² 16 A/mm²
Max Temperature 105°C 125°C

Specialized Low-Voltage Applications

Low-voltage systems demand precise engineering to combat voltage drops caused by reduced contact surface areas.

Automotive and 12V Power Management

  1. Vibration Resistance: Heavy duty automotive electrical connectors employ multi-point contact springs to counteract vehicle harmonic vibrations.

  2. Contact Integrity: High-grade plating prevents micro-motion corrosion in heavy duty 12v connectors.

  3. Sealing Mechanisms: Compact silicone gaskets protect heavy duty 12 volt connectors from moisture ingress.

  4. Current Efficiency: Optimized crimping zones ensure a reliable 12v heavy duty connector minimizes thermal dissipation.

Summary of Mechanical Optimization

Miniaturized connector longevity depends on strict adherence to contact force calculations and thermal dissipation modeling. Precision-engineered locking systems ensure that physical size reductions do not compromise secure mating cycles or environmental shielding in rugged operating conditions.
